We know you've been dreaming of it — we have too! Kashi™ Granola is a delicious and nutritious start to the day or for a snack on the go.

We begin with our heritage Seven Whole Grains, freshly harvested and then gently rolled to preserve their nutty flavors and unique textures. They're mixed with a touch of golden honey and the grains are then baked into perfectly crunchy granola clusters. Finally we added lots of goodies like chewy fruits and crunchy nuts to create granolas that are both tasty and good for you.
Each serving of Kashi Granola is packed with powerful nutrition:

  • Good Fats—300mg Omega 3
  • Whole Grains—over two—thirds of your daily needs
  • High Fiber—25% of your daily fiber needs*
  • All Natural—No preservatives or artificial sweeteners and flavors

* Contains 7g total fat per serving

Mountain Medley

Mountain Medley will remind you of your favorite trail mix. Toasted seven whole grain clusters are mixed with: a touch of honey and maple; chewy cranberries and raisins; crunchy almonds and pecans; and delicious sunflower seeds and coconut flakes.
